While official proprietary JCOP English software requires enterprise clearance from NXP, developers have excellent free options. Utilizing open-source tools like GlobalPlatformPro provides the exact same functionality—allowing you to load applets, manage keys, and execute APDUs safely without compromising your computer's security.
